Simplified mcmaniac event

This commit is contained in:
mrhanky 2017-05-30 16:13:20 +02:00
parent e7a6501c7d
commit 2dd9289ffd
No known key found for this signature in database
GPG Key ID: 67D772C481CB41B8

View File

@ -42,9 +42,7 @@ class McManiac(DatabasePlugin):
if result:
return '[{idx}/{len}] {item}'.format(**result)
@irc3.event(r'(?i)^:(?P<mask>\S+) PRIVMSG \S+ :'
r'(?P<msg>.*(?P<item>Mc\S+iaC).*)')
def save(self, mask: str, msg: str, item: str):
nick = IrcString(mask).nick
if nick != self.bot.nick and msg != '.reload mcmaniac':
@irc3.event(r'(?i)^:(?P<mask>\S+) PRIVMSG \S+ :.*(?P<item>Mc\S+iaC).*')
def save(self, mask: str, item: str):
if IrcString(mask).nick != self.bot.nick:
self._insert(item=item)